Tire Maintenance



Before winter season shows up, check your tires for correct rising cost of living and tread deepness. Properly filled with air tires give much better grip on snowy and icy roads, minimizing the threat of skidding or obtaining stuck. Utilize a tire pressure scale to guarantee each tire matches the suggested stress detailed in your vehicle's guidebook. Low tire stress can bring about reduced fuel efficiency and compromised handling in wintertime conditions.

Evaluate the step deepness of your tires to assure they're suitable for winter driving. Worn-out treads can diminish traction, specifically on unsafe surface areas. Think about purchasing wintertime tires for boosted hold and efficiency in snow and ice. Additionally, rotating your tires frequently advertises even wear, extending their life-span and enhancing their efficiency throughout the chillier months.

Bear in mind to likewise examine your tires for indications of damages, such as cuts or bulges. Any kind of problems should be dealt with without delay to avoid possible safety hazards when traveling. By taking these proactive actions, you can guarantee your tires prepare to deal with the challenges of winter driving.

Emergency Kit Fundamentals



Regularly checking your fluids is just the beginning; now allow's cover the key basics you require in your emergency situation package for wintertime driving.

Firstly, make certain to have a totally charged portable phone battery charger in case you need to call for help. Additionally, consist of a standard first aid package with things like plasters, disinfectant wipes, and pain relievers.

A flashlight with added batteries can be crucial if you find yourself stranded at night. It's likewise important to pack some non-perishable treats like granola bars and mineral water in case you're stuck for a prolonged period.

A warm covering or extra winter clothing, such as handwear covers and hats, can offer convenience and heat if your vehicle breaks down in winter. A tiny shovel can assist you remove of snow if required.

Finally, consider including a reflective warning triangular or flares to make your automobile much more noticeable to various other chauffeurs in case of an emergency. By having these basics in your emergency situation package, you'll be much better gotten ready for any type of unforeseen scenarios while driving in winter season conditions.
